On-ice testing
Here’s a look at our new on-ice testing approach. The test allows us to measure: maximal power generated, critical power, time to exhaustion, breathing rate, breathing amplitude heart rate, biomechanical efficiency. A report is produced following the test, with recommendations on the training necessary to improve the performance of the player.
New protocols are now validated to evaluate the rehabilitation process following an injury. We are able to measure the difference in power of both legs and thus determine if the player has fully recovered.
